DNR COLORADO <br /> CO Division of Reclamation, <br /> Mining and Safety <br /> Department of Natural Resources <br /> 1313 Sherman Street, Room 215 <br /> Denver, CO 80203 <br /> November 24, 2017 <br /> Notice to Colorado Permittees, Operators and Prospectors <br /> RE: Electronic Filing of Annual Fees and Reports <br /> Dear Permittee, Operator and/or Prospector: <br /> On the anniversary date of a permit,notice of intent to conduct prospecting,or notice of intent to <br /> conduct exploration,all permit holders are required to submit an annual report,with map,and pay an <br /> annual fee. The process whereby permittees comply with this requirement has remained largely <br /> unchanged since the reclamation statute was implemented some 40 years ago. Given the quantity and <br /> diversity of permits issued by this Office,the traditional paper process has become inefficient. <br /> The Office has completed an extensive review of the annual reporting process. The review focused not <br /> only on the efficiency of the process,but also how to assist permittee compliance with the law. The <br /> review included an 18-month voluntary pilot project whereby permittees uploaded their annual <br /> report, map and fee in a secure electronic environment. The pilot project is part of a larger effort to <br /> develop paperless ePermitting,an effort pursued by the Office since 2013. Documents and <br /> information received through ePermitting are conveyed directly to the database and to the imaged <br /> documents repository(Laserfiche WebLink),and are immediately available for review by the Office, <br /> other governmental agencies,and the public. The ePermitting pilot project demonstrated substantial <br /> improvements in the efficiency and effectiveness of the annual reporting process. <br /> Therefore,beginning January 1, 2018,the Office will require electronic filing for the annual report, <br /> map and fee,for all permits and/or notices of intent. Permittees who have already registered for <br /> ePermitting will receive an electronic notice to the email address registered with the Office,reminding <br /> them of the due date to complete the online report,attach a map,and pay the annual fee. Permittees <br /> who have not yet registered for ePermitting will be mailed (paper) an annual report notice 30-days <br /> prior to the due date; the notice will include instructions for completing the required electronic <br /> submittal. <br /> ePermitting Sign-up <br /> • ePermitting Sign-up: Securing an account for the ePermitting system is an easy process that <br /> will take about five minutes.
